Minimum Qualifications/Requirements:
- Must reside in the state of Ohio.
- Associate, Bachelor's, master's degree in the respective discipline or related area
- Ability to use technology in teaching and healthcare settings
- to communicate effectively and maintain positive working relationships with students, peers, supervisors, and staff.
- work in the clinical setting and maintain health and shot records/background checks and drug screens as required by the clinical facility
- Willingness to teach and communicate using a variety of instructional modes, email and online learning management systems.
- Commitment to meeting students' learning needs and empowering students in their learning endeavors.
- Personal and educational philosophy compatible with the mission, values, goals, and objectives of Central Ohio Technical College.
- Requires successful completion of a background check.
Preferred Qualifications:
- A master's degree from a regionally accredited institution of higher education in the subject area.
- Previous teaching experience and experience with curriculum development and assessment.
Summary of Duties:
All applications for part-time faculty positions are placed in an applicant pool. As positions become available based on operational needs, we will review applications and reach out to candidates whose qualifications best match our current openings. If selected for further consideration, we will contact you directly.
All applicants must reside in the state of Ohio.
Instruction and Student Learning
- Deliver high-quality instruction that aligns with course objectives and institutional standards.
- Develop and implement engaging lesson plans, assignments, and assessments to support student learning.
- Utilize diverse instructional strategies, including technology-enhanced learning, to accommodate various learning styles.
- Provide timely and constructive feedback to students to promote academic growth.
- Maintain accurate records of student performance, attendance, and assessments in accordance with college policies.
Student Engagement & Advisement
- Foster a supportive and inclusive learning environment that encourages student participation.
- Serve as an academic resource for students, offering guidance on coursework, study strategies, and academic progress.
- Encourage student engagement through active discussions, collaborative projects, and real-world applications of course material.
- Be available for student inquiries and provide office hours or virtual support as needed.
Culture of Respect
- Promote an inclusive classroom environment that values individual differences and mutual respect.
- Model professional behavior and ethical conduct in interactions with students, colleagues, and staff.
- Uphold academic integrity and encourage a culture of honesty and accountability.
- Address student concerns with empathy and professionalism while adhering to institutional policies.
- Support and contribute to a positive, respectful college community that enhances the overall student experience.
